Klagen gibt es erst wenn man Funktionen verspricht, die nicht eingehalten wurden. Für Fehler sichert man sich in der Regel durch einen Lizenzvertrag ab. Natürlich sollte man Fehler überhaupt vermeiden, aber das ist ein Ding der Unmöglichkeit.
Das sag noch mal, wenn durch einen Lapsus in unserem Programm das Grundwasser in 50km Umkreis um dein Haus potenziell mit einem mutagen wirksamen Nervengift verseucht ist. Das will ich sehen, dass man da so locker raus kommt. (Bezieht sich jetzt mehr auf die SPS Programmierung, weil da so sicherheitsrelevante Dinge hin müssen, aber auch da kann man "oops" bauen.)
Zudem gibt es einen großen Unterschied zwischen "fast fertig und voll benutzbar", und FMX.
@iPhone/iPad: Wenn, dann würden die Geräte explizit für diese Zwecke angeschafft. Rate mal, wer dem Kunden brühwarm von Apple abraten würde, und für einen Knallerpreis eine Alternative auf Android anböte, die ich komplett mit freier Software programmieren kann?
(Abgesehen davon bietet Apple
imho nichtmal brauchbare Geräte an. Diese müssten nämlich mit einer "rigid shell" kommen, und oftmals auch noch in Ex Ausführung.)
"When one person suffers from a delusion, it is called insanity. When a million people suffer from a delusion, it is called religion." (Richard Dawkins)